Transaction 685319610a5413b846b1671f5fe7cd4a9054cac8d975ead7027664f46794d898

4 Input
2 Outputs
  • 685319610a5413b846b1671f5fe7cd4a9054cac8d975ead7027664f46794d898:0
  • value  27036
    address  3MmSux36xN2suEUoxBM9wSpb8NSzX1Cyxn
  • 685319610a5413b846b1671f5fe7cd4a9054cac8d975ead7027664f46794d898:1
  • value  1000010
    address  39PF5mJ3vShNzNaenNjPctggQJbx4WFqEH